>> Ok, so here's the embarrassing follow-up story.  I did not buy a borescope, 
>> figured I'd try fiddling with the dipstick one more time and then pull the 
>> engine out (fortunately just the long block, nothing else bolted on yet) and 
>> fix the oil pan baffle that I must have installed in the wrong position 
>> somehow.
>> 
>> Stuck the dipstick in the hole in the block, it hit metal.  Tried rotating 
>> it, no help.  Went to pull the dipstick out of the other engine in the 
>> garage, figured I'd try that, and looking at the other engine I immediately 
>> knew what was wrong.
>> 
>> Went back to my parts bench where all the disassembled car parts sit, found 
>> the dipstick and dipstick tube that I'd pulled out of the engine back in 
>> November and put them in.  Everything worked fine.  Figure it out yet?
>> 
>> I had been trying to install a spare dipstick siting on the bench, without a 
>> dipstick tube, and had been inserting that directly into the block, and 
>> hitting the bottom of the pan.  
>> 
>> The missing part - the dipstick tube!  Good for about 4" of dipstick depth - 
>> of course the dipstick was hitting something!
>> 
>> It's a wonder I get anything done.  Sometimes, after a long day in the 
>> garage, the powers of observation are apparently weak.
